Commit Graph

  • 8fb00d5293 feat(): openapi docs for resume gitgernit 2025-11-21 22:25:36 +03:00
  • b6048c50c2 FIX|AIFaoewufiohwrgushe ITQ 2025-11-21 22:07:36 +03:00
  • 073c1f75c7 AAAAAAAAAAAAAAAAAAAA ITQ 2025-11-21 21:49:34 +03:00
  • 01d560dc15 ABE<ME<EEEE ITQ 2025-11-21 21:16:09 +03:00
  • 9e35a2249e a ITQ 2025-11-21 21:04:03 +03:00
  • 33309e6f8b ABOBA ITQ 2025-11-21 20:50:03 +03:00
  • 91dbd4cb35 Merge branch 'main' of gitlab.prodcontest.com:team-39/backend ITQ 2025-11-21 20:14:20 +03:00
  • 8352538892 aboba ITQ 2025-11-21 20:14:14 +03:00
  • 44b10a1a03 Merge remote-tracking branch 'origin/main' gitgernit 2025-11-21 20:02:46 +03:00
  • fe0433bf62 feat(): openapi docs for resume routes gitgernit 2025-11-21 20:02:39 +03:00
  • f334e1f2cc afnzsljdghskjerlg ITQ 2025-11-21 19:29:00 +03:00
  • 44df678c82 chore: added iac ITQ 2025-11-21 18:16:52 +03:00
  • 5d66fcd0ca some quirky changes ITQ 2025-11-21 16:47:34 +03:00
  • 1d279af3c9 aboiba ITQ 2025-11-21 16:03:15 +03:00
  • fb307da70a fix: fixed Containerfile ITQ 2025-11-21 15:50:24 +03:00
  • 821103138e <type>(scope): <description> i ITQ 2025-11-21 15:38:02 +03:00
  • 7d8585d9f6 chore: improvements in Containerfile ITQ 2025-11-21 15:32:03 +03:00
  • 554fe27a79 chore: switched build impl to buildah ITQ 2025-11-21 15:31:47 +03:00
  • 5dc0ceea34 Merge remote-tracking branch 'origin/main' gitgernit 2025-11-21 13:46:04 +03:00
  • 483c7f90ea feat(): add validation and documentation to input schemas gitgernit 2025-11-21 13:45:52 +03:00
  • c3e0967045 Merge branch 'refactor/tests' into 'main' Ivan Kirpichnikov 2025-11-21 10:17:27 +00:00
  • acc5e19731 fix lint ivankirpichnikov 2025-11-21 13:13:17 +03:00
  • 5f14cc3fee fix merge conflicts ivankirpichnikov 2025-11-21 13:12:24 +03:00
  • 2319b471a0 refactor tests ivankirpichnikov 2025-11-21 13:11:48 +03:00
  • c00c965280 fix: fixed tests execution ITQ 2025-11-21 12:58:55 +03:00
  • 3eb4666eff chore: some improvements ITQ 2025-11-21 12:37:07 +03:00
  • 46f532060d Merge branch 'main' of https://gitlab.com/prod-hackathon-moscow/hackaton ITQ 2025-11-21 12:27:03 +03:00
  • ef4f2ec999 feat(): storage upload file route gitgernit 2025-11-21 12:11:40 +03:00
  • 0b818e13d0 Merge branch 'main' of https://gitlab.com/prod-hackathon-moscow/hackaton ITQ 2025-11-21 11:09:38 +03:00
  • a0db6b149b chore: allowed lint stage to fail ITQ 2025-11-21 11:08:43 +03:00
  • fb6c415f1e Merge branch 'feature/s3' into 'main' Ivan Kirpichnikov 2025-11-21 08:03:24 +00:00
  • 159fa8320c fix ci ivankirpichnikov 2025-11-21 10:59:40 +03:00
  • e46dae56bb fix ci ivankirpichnikov 2025-11-21 10:56:08 +03:00
  • f19ebea56d fix ci ivankirpichnikov 2025-11-21 10:52:13 +03:00
  • b3ebbe283b fix ci ivankirpichnikov 2025-11-21 10:49:09 +03:00
  • cd721b4cf3 fix ci ivankirpichnikov 2025-11-21 10:46:40 +03:00
  • 92a4e5c50c fix ci ivankirpichnikov 2025-11-21 10:42:18 +03:00
  • 07c0434589 add StorageProvider ivankirpichnikov 2025-11-21 10:39:49 +03:00
  • 7b7725713d fix ci ivankirpichnikov 2025-11-21 10:36:05 +03:00
  • 7eb2372ca3 fix ci ivankirpichnikov 2025-11-21 10:32:36 +03:00
  • 75299e1b25 fix merge conflict ivankirpichnikov 2025-11-21 10:25:09 +03:00
  • 97eebe9acd feature: add s3 ivankirpichnikov 2025-11-21 10:22:04 +03:00
  • 262ac5cc38 chore: improved Justfile ITQ 2025-11-21 09:44:44 +03:00
  • f23c4cbe6d feat: instrumented backend with prometheus endpoint ITQ 2025-11-21 09:44:35 +03:00
  • 2e0470a833 fix(): revert gitlab ci gitgernit 2025-11-21 09:43:18 +03:00
  • 2e073146bf feat(): register device route gitgernit 2025-11-21 00:18:55 +03:00
  • 301ea62557 Merge branch 'main' of gitlab.com:prod-hackathon-moscow/hackaton gitgernit 2025-11-20 23:21:18 +03:00
  • 9e917b6a40 fix: fixed typo ITQ 2025-11-20 22:23:24 +03:00
  • 9d7e954179 chore: added .gitignore ITQ 2025-11-20 22:17:39 +03:00
  • 7b580881ae fix: fixed tests ITQ 2025-11-20 22:17:18 +03:00
  • 36b0bd1cb4 chore: added firebase conf to tests run ITQ 2025-11-20 21:49:56 +03:00
  • cb1c417541 fix(): proper config dependency resolution doas root 2025-11-20 21:43:08 +03:00
  • 8a3f8f3bd5 fix(): add firebase section to configs doas root 2025-11-20 21:34:00 +03:00
  • b395e70317 Merge branch 'main' of https://gitlab.com/prod-hackathon-moscow/hackaton doas root 2025-11-20 21:26:42 +03:00
  • fa24f4060f feat(): push notifications via firebase admin doas root 2025-11-20 21:25:48 +03:00
  • 0ae844f10c feat: added dangerous tagging after all validation steps pass ITQ 2025-11-20 20:32:05 +03:00
  • 2675a642da feat: added dangerous tagging after all validation steps pass ITQ 2025-11-20 20:32:05 +03:00
  • c010984d64 fix: added venv activation to lint stage ITQ 2025-11-20 19:53:57 +03:00
  • b3c368f9af fix: added validation for crypto_key ITQ 2025-11-20 19:53:41 +03:00
  • f93c5a5966 feat: added e2e, unit tests and improved tests pipeline ITQ 2025-11-20 19:39:20 +03:00
  • 4ac902cf3b chore: small improvements ITQ 2025-11-20 19:08:11 +03:00
  • 1941a633c0 chore: coverage report improvements ITQ 2025-11-20 16:38:21 +03:00
  • faad52d422 chore: improved and fixed Justfile ITQ 2025-11-20 16:38:02 +03:00
  • 5fb325f3c7 chore: small improvements ITQ 2025-11-20 16:37:33 +03:00
  • 5a12e609fb fix: fixed unimported statement ITQ 2025-11-20 16:11:41 +03:00
  • 6ca6bd4e34 Merge branch 'main' of https://gitlab.com/prod-hackathon-moscow/hackaton doas root 2025-11-20 11:04:24 +03:00
  • bbad18f8d2 fix(): provide oauth for test ioc doas root 2025-11-20 11:03:48 +03:00
  • 123ecc9c54 fix: added yandex oath conf to sample configs ITQ 2025-11-20 09:43:49 +03:00
  • 1cbc71cf19 ci: improvements in log capturing ITQ 2025-11-20 08:42:52 +03:00
  • 8e913479bc chore: small improvements ITQ 2025-11-20 07:34:26 +03:00
  • 52f3072729 feat(): profiles doas root 2025-11-20 01:37:19 +03:00
  • 8c7ce13922 feat(): yandex and email sign in doas root 2025-11-19 01:27:15 +03:00
  • 81cf298b5a feat(): yandex sign up route doas root 2025-11-19 00:16:36 +03:00
  • 0992e6c038 feat(): yandex sign up interactor doas root 2025-11-18 23:53:58 +03:00
  • beeca57c1e feat(): yandex oauth client doas root 2025-11-18 23:01:42 +03:00
  • 3bea2c2f75 Merge branch 'main' of https://gitlab.com/prod-hackathon-moscow/hackaton doas root 2025-11-18 00:25:35 +03:00
  • f44e688662 feat(): migrate to auth identity doas root 2025-11-18 00:25:24 +03:00
  • 63a057b020 fix(): revert filtered entities solution as it sucks ass doas root 2025-11-17 23:38:24 +03:00
  • 01227027e8 fix: fix trivy access to registry ITQ 2025-11-17 22:58:24 +03:00
  • 393f66a206 fix(): copy domain entities upon uow.add doas root 2025-11-17 22:58:26 +03:00
  • e7e3cf2b0f fix: fixed default template in CI ITQ 2025-11-17 22:43:26 +03:00
  • 5e5566388e ci: added integration tests and fixed trivy ITQ 2025-11-17 22:27:07 +03:00
  • b88cee3e48 chore: CI improvements ITQ 2025-11-17 21:15:58 +03:00
  • 49082ddf03 fix: added alembic.ini copy to migrations stage ITQ 2025-11-17 20:53:57 +03:00
  • 7876763ff5 feat: added sample GitLab CI ITQ 2025-11-13 22:32:10 +03:00
  • 436ba6b04e refacor: fully refactored infrastructure ITQ 2025-11-13 21:05:51 +03:00
  • 89dffcabbd fix(): add flush to uow.add to ensure db sync doas root 2025-11-12 00:10:58 +03:00
  • 08a2ae6456 feat(): format & proper startup (make main async for uvicorn to inherit current asyncio event loop) doas root 2025-11-10 23:19:51 +03:00
  • 5ca3e72834 fix(): change web_api command to invoke uv as venv contents are seemingly not copied into path doas root 2025-11-10 22:24:00 +03:00
  • 70c5d360de fix(): define hatchling package to build doas root 2025-11-10 22:22:42 +03:00
  • ad914aaece Merge branch 'master' doas root 2025-11-10 21:50:06 +03:00
  • e29a895c84 chore(): add hatchling as build system doas root 2025-11-10 21:48:19 +03:00
  • 45d7926af1 add tests and docker infra ivankirpichnikov 2025-10-17 02:21:46 +03:00
  • 31d06fc0b4 add lints ivankirpichnikov 2025-10-16 23:11:04 +03:00
  • 2ae3323b1e fix mypy ivankirpichnikov 2025-10-16 23:06:10 +03:00
  • 652da07d12 fast init ivankirpichnikov 2025-10-16 23:03:50 +03:00
  • b84e0370d6 Initial commit Ivan Kirpichnikov 2025-10-16 23:01:52 +03:00
  • a3adc8ddcd Initial commit doas root 2025-10-04 21:37:45 +03:00